Background

DIB Bank Kenya Limited (DIBBKE), is a fully owned subsidiary of Dubai Islamic Bank PJSC (AE) - a pioneering institution that has combined the best of traditional, Shariah values with technology and innovation that characterize the best of modern banking.

Job Purpose

The job holder will develop the sales plans in line with overall Corporate and Commercial Business Plans and manage different customers within the Corporate and Commercial Business segment. Additionally, he/she will ensure that product revenue and profitability targets are achieved / exceeded.

Key Responsibilities

  • Ensuring that product revenue and profitability targets are achieved / exceeded by understanding the customer’s business and to anticipate the requirements through a consultative selling process.
  • Matching the customer’s needs with product capabilities through presentation of tailored demonstrations and proposals.
  • Negotiating/renegotiating terms and conditions with customers to maximize revenue and profitability.
  • To identify opportunities for cross selling and referrals to other Banking lines through developing a good understanding of client needs
  • Providing structured solutions to meet the specific cash management requirements of our customers and prospects.
  • Undertaking a disciplined product-oriented sales management process while monitoring, tracking, and reporting on sales activity on a periodic basis and to ensure action is taken to meet sales targets.
  • Assisting the product management and development in strategic product rollouts.
  • Support customers’ seeds, trends, and product/market intelligence for new product developments/enhancements, strengthening competitive position.
  • Facilitate customer service issues and ensure a high level of post sales service is always made available to the clients.
  • Any other duties may be assigned by the team leader from time to time.

Job Specification

  • Bachelor’s degree in Business Management or related field from a recognized university.
  • Minimum of Five (5) Years Banking experience with at least 3 years in business development for Corporate/commercial segment.
  • Excellent financial acumen & analytical thinking skills
  • Excellent sales and marketing skills
  • Strong interpersonal skills
  • In depth knowledge of commercial banking products
  • Excellent sales and marketing skills
  • Sharia Foundations & principles of Islamic finance will be an added advantage.
